Students must pay INR 35,000 per year for their BCA studies at Sridevi First Grade College for the duration of 3 years which amounts to INR 1,05,000. First-year expenses at Sridevi First Grade College contain tuition costs of INR 25,000 and admission expenses of INR 5,000 as well as various fees amounting to INR 5,000. The annual fees in each of the second and third years amount to INR 30,000 and INR 35,000 respectively.

For getting admission into the BCA programme at SDJ International College, Surat, the applicants should have passed 10+2 from a recognised board with minimum 50% aggregate marks. Mathematics is compulsory. Admission is given on the basis of CBSE 12th or GSEB HSC score. The applicants have to apply online from the official website of the college by submitting the application form, attaching required documents, and paying the application fee. Shortlisted students have documents verified and pay the admission fee to reserve a seat. The duration of the course is three years.

To be eligible for the BCA in Data Science program at SRM Ramapuram, you need to have passed your 10+2 (Higher Secondary) examination with a minimum of 50% aggregate and have studied Mathematics/Business Mathematics/Statistics/Allied Mathematics as one of the core subjects.

Yes, Anna University releases separate answer keys for the MBA and MCA courses under TANCET exam. Candidates can check the answer keys for both courses on the official TANCET website by logging into their respective dashboards. This allows candidates to compare their answers and calculate their estimated scores for each specific course.
TANCET answer keys for MBA and MCA courses are available inside the dashboard in a PDF format.

Other than the delivery mode and cost, there's no significant difference. Both have the same curriculum, duration, and value. Online MCA is self-paced and affordable. Regular MCA offers a full-time college experience but may require relocation and higher costs.
